Speak Spanish?

If you speak Spanish and you’re a transfer student, you may qualify for the EC-6 bilingual education program and additional scholarships.

Teach the next generation of bilingual students

With your bilingual elementary education degree from TXWES, you'll be prepared to positively impact the lives of dual-language learners. You'll learn more than teaching techniques and lesson planning — you'll open doors to greater educational and career opportunities.

Advantages to a bilingual education degree

Bilingual teachers are in high demand statewide, in big cities and small towns. Some school districts even award bilingual teachers additional money, ranging from $2,000 to $4,000 per year.

 

Bilingual education program scholarships

Transfer students are automatically eligible for up to $20,000 in university scholarships depending on their transfer GPA. See what transfer scholarship you qualify for below:

A table showing the potential scholarships for students based on their GPA 

Transfer scholarship award amounts are determined by the 2023-2024 tuition rate.

To qualify, you'll need to meet the admission requirements for the university and apply to the education program as an EC-6 bilingual education major. Don't wait to apply. Scholarships are awarded on a first-come, first-served basis.
